Not a robbery. He was pissed about pictures, then supposedly threatened to kill the clerk, left, came back with a gun. Clerk killed him and wounded two people thought to be involved with the pissed off customer. Or so theyre reporting right now on the news. The other two were just wounded. Clerk might lose a job but is alive.

Just read a report that the Clerk has a permit, he shot the perp, as he was falling his firearm discharged and another employee was hit. Somehow a Customer was hit as well, but no indication where that shot came from.
